Hear what ex-President Obasanjo told Accord Presidential candidate

 You can emerge as the next Nigerian President…

Ex-President Obasanjo tells Prof. Imumolen

 


By: Oriaifoh Godwins


General Olusegun Obasanjo, a onetime Head of state, and former President of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, recently in his country home in Ota, Ogun state, told Professor Imumolen the Accord Presidential candidate that, it is possible for him to be the next president of the Federal Republic of Nigeria.


Professor Imumolen, the Accord Presidential candidate in the upcoming 2023 general election, revealed this on Saturday, 10th September 2022 at the Palace of His Royal Highness, Barr. Anthony Abumere II, the Onojie of Ekpoma, Edo state, where all the traditional rulers of the different kingdoms in Esanland gathered to pray for his victory in the upcoming presidential election.


Continuing, Prof. Imumolen said; ‘…ex-President Olusegun Obasanjo told me that, if he could come out of prison to become the president of Nigeria, then you can be the president of this country, as there is nothing God can not do….’


Professor Imumolen said, as the youngest by age, amongst all the Presidential candidates in the race, he is bringing fresh ideas to governance. He also added that, Nigerians are currently tired of the old order. ‘…you cannot use analogue solutions to solve digital problems…’ He said.


‘…Nigeria has degenerated to a point where it is no longer about political parties. Rather, we need a leader that has demonstrated proven, sincere and genuine antecedent in lifting people out of the level they are, to a higher welfare level…’ continuing, Professor Imumolen said; ‘…I will not campaign with promises, but with solutions. Nigerians should begin to identify political leaders that not only have the ideas to solve the country’s problems, but those that can as well, actualize the ideas…’


Professor Christopher Imumolen, a double PhD holder in Engineering research and Educational Management, is the President of Global Wealth System, the President of UNIC Foundation who has made many millionaires, gifted several people cars and also empowered and supported others in their businesses. He is a seasoned entrepreneur and philanthropist extraordinaire.
